Name: RYK
Organism: Homo sapiens
Description: receptor like tyrosine kinase [Source:HGNC Symbol;Acc:HGNC:10481]
Ensembl version: ENSG00000163785.14
RefSeq: NM_001005861
CCDS: CCDS75016
ORF Length: 1833 bp
